I need to stop my Do While loop at cell 52. Cell 53 has information that I don't want to include. My starting row is 8. I need the loop to 'do while" column A equals anything other than blank "" from row 8 through row 52, but after 52 I need it to move to my next worksheet. Here is a sample of my code:

row = 8 'starting row for worksheet-1
            Do While ActiveWorkbook.Sheets("WorkSheet-1").Cells(row, 1).Value <> ""
                    With ThisWorkbook.Sheets("TAGSTEMPLATE")
                            .Range("TAGN" & PAGETAGNUM).Value = ActiveWorkbook.Sheets("WorkSheet-1").Cells(row, 2).Value
                            .Range("EQPN" & PAGETAGNUM).Value = equipment
                            .Range("DATE" & PAGETAGNUM).Value = printdate
                            .Range("ISOT" & PAGETAGNUM).Value = ActiveWorkbook.Sheets("WorkSheet-1").Cells(row, 1).Value
                            .Range("TASK" & PAGETAGNUM).Value = task
                            .Range("ISOL" & PAGETAGNUM).Value = ActiveWorkbook.Sheets("WorkSheet-1").Cells(row, 5).Value
                            .Range("VALP" & PAGETAGNUM).Value = ActiveWorkbook.Sheets("WorkSheet-1").Cells(row, 8).Value
                    End With
                    PAGETAGNUM = PAGETAGNUM + 1
                    If PAGETAGNUM > 6 Then
                        Call printandclear
                        PAGETAGNUM = 1
                    End If
                row = row + 1
            Loop
            
        row = 8 'starting row for worksheet-2
            Do While ActiveWorkbook.Sheets("WorkSheet-2").Cells(row, 1).Value <> ""
                    With ThisWorkbook.Sheets("TAGSTEMPLATE")
                            .Range("TAGN" & PAGETAGNUM).Value = ActiveWorkbook.Sheets("WorkSheet-2").Cells(row, 2).Value
                            .Range("EQPN" & PAGETAGNUM).Value = equipment
                            .Range("DATE" & PAGETAGNUM).Value = printdate
                            .Range("ISOT" & PAGETAGNUM).Value = ActiveWorkbook.Sheets("WorkSheet-2").Cells(row, 1).Value
                            .Range("TASK" & PAGETAGNUM).Value = task
                            .Range("ISOL" & PAGETAGNUM).Value = ActiveWorkbook.Sheets("WorkSheet-2").Cells(row, 5).Value
                            .Range("VALP" & PAGETAGNUM).Value = ActiveWorkbook.Sheets("WorkSheet-2").Cells(row, 8).Value
                    End With
                    PAGETAGNUM = PAGETAGNUM + 1
                    If PAGETAGNUM > 6 Then
                        Call printandclear
                        PAGETAGNUM = 1
                    End If
                row = row + 1
            Loop